The Trailsman: The Devil’s Playground In Order
The Trailsman series, created by Jon Sharpe, captures the essence of frontier life in the American West. Each book follows the adventures of Skye Fargo, a rugged and resourceful guide known as “The Trailsman.” He travels across various states, facing numerous challenges, and confronting both human foes and the rigors of unpredictable nature.
